Class ApplicationDescriptor

java.lang.Object
com.aeontronix.enhancedmule.tools.application.ApplicationDescriptor

public class ApplicationDescriptor extends Object
  • Constructor Details

    • ApplicationDescriptor

      public ApplicationDescriptor()
  • Method Details

    • findAnypointFile

      public static File findAnypointFile(File basedir)
    • createDefault

      public static ApplicationDescriptor createDefault()
    • createDefault

      public static com.fasterxml.jackson.databind.JsonNode createDefault(com.fasterxml.jackson.databind.ObjectMapper objectMapper)
    • getName

      public String getName()
    • setName

      public void setName(String name)
    • getMule3

      public Boolean getMule3()
    • setMule3

      public void setMule3(Boolean mule3)
    • getApi

      public APIDescriptor getApi()
    • setApi

      public void setApi(APIDescriptor api)
    • getId

      public String getId()
    • setId

      public void setId(String id)
    • getClient

      public ClientApplicationDescriptor getClient()
    • setClient

      public void setClient(ClientApplicationDescriptor client)
    • getVersion

      public String getVersion()
    • setVersion

      public void setVersion(String version)
    • getDescription

      public String getDescription()
    • setDescription

      public void setDescription(String description)
    • getDeploymentParams

      @NotNull public @NotNull DeploymentParameters getDeploymentParams()
    • setDeploymentParams

      public void setDeploymentParams(DeploymentParameters deploymentParams)
    • isAssetPublish

      public boolean isAssetPublish()